When my wife and I were building up our SG on Protector and had 2 teleporters we chose:
1) King's Row to be near the Yellow line (this one was frequently switched out)
2) Steel Canyon to be near the Green Line, Tailor, and Boomtown
3) Brickstown to be near Crey's Folley
4) Dark Astoria because it is just so far out of the way
If we didn't have the GvE Pocket D porter we would have done that instead of KR.
Between those, Pocket D and the Ouroboros portal we could get almost anywhere without too much trouble. We also both had permission to change the base so we would frequently change out King's Row to be Faultline, Striga, Talos or wherever we happen to be rampaging at the time.
With the train merger I'd definitely switch out KR to be Perez Park or Striga with the understanding that changing them out on the fly is not that difficult.
And chin up, we now have 7 teleporters going to 13 locations and never have a problem going anywhere we like. If we can do that in a 2-person SG in less than a year of sporadic play anyone can. -

I would think it would vary depending on the character. I know it has for me and I only have 3 level 50's only one of which has managed to craft a Boost.
My Dark/Dark tanker definitely got the Cardiac because the endurance was still an issue sometimes (she was slotted to assume my /rad teammate was always available which isn't necessarily true at 50th level) and of course the secondary is resist which gave me a very nice boost to my resistances. I'm very happy with the way she's turned out with the boost.
My MA/Regen is working toward getting the Spiritual because the recharge/heal would be a great match. It would help all the click-powers Regen has come up more often and be more effective when used.
My DB/SR scrapper is going musculature for the little extra damage as she is near-perfect as-is already. -
